PUBLIC NOTICES. TARANAKI LAND DISTRICT. LAND FOR DISCHARGED SOLDIERS. HUIA SETTLEMENT (MAIR HOWIE’S ESTATE). 1554 ACRES, and KARU SETTLEMENT (FISHER’S), 148 S ACRES. ■VOTICE is hereby given that five sections in Ohura Survey District (ad- ; jacent to Ohura Township) and five secI tions in Totoro Survey District (74 miles from Pio Pio) in areas from 242’t0 408 acres will be open for selection on Special Tenures to discharged soldiers only at the District Lands and Survey Office, New Plymouth, up to 4 p.m. on FRIDAY, February 18, 1921. Applicants must appear personally before the Land Board for examination at Gardiner’s Hall, Taumarunui, on MONDAY, February 21, 1921, at 10 o’clock a.m., but if any applicant so ' desires he may be examined by the ! Land Board of any -other district. The j ballot will be held at Gardiner’s Hall, ■ Taumafunui, at the conclusion of the I examination of applicants. Applications anc plans may be'‘obtained at this office, and plans may be s#en at the principal Post Offices in the , Distrmt. G. H. BULLARD, Commissioner of Crown Lands. J District Lands and Survey Office, I New Plymouth, February 1, 1921.
